乙二醛用于加固饱水漆木器的研究 被引量:11

Studies on the Use of Glyoxal in Consolidating Waterlogged Lacquerware

摘要 在阐述饱水文物一般脱水方法的基础上 ,着重介绍乙二醛经浓缩处理后作为填充加固剂的应用实例 ,操作步骤 ,注意事项等等。其中用乙二醛加固的二件饱水木块 (含水率为 70 0 % )在长度、高度、宽度三个方向的收缩率分别为 1 .0 9%~ 1 .54%、0 .0 8%~ 0 .42 %、0 .39%~ 0 .41 % ,列举了用乙二醛对一件汉代漆器和四件木胎战国剑鞘的处理效果。此外 ,还运用红外光谱和质谱法测定了试剂乙二醛和加固液的结构 ,详细讨论了乙二酯在试剂和加固液中官能团的存在形式和聚合状态的细微变化 ,指出在二种溶液中并不存在醛基 ,乙二醛仅以水合物的形式存在并讨论了乙二醛与饱水古木的作用机理 ,提出用醇溶液能有效控制乙二醛使用中易返酸等问题。 The use of a new bulking solution made of glyoxal to treat waterlogged ancient matters and the steps of operation are described. There are several living examples in this paper. Particularly, before and after treatment two waterlogged woods (water content is 700%) have the size change from 1.09% to 1.54% in length, from 0.08% to 0.42% in hight and from 0.39% to 0.41% in width, photos of one Chinese lacquerwares (Han Dynasty BC206-AD220) and 4 sheaths made of wood (Warring States) are cited to show the effect of treatment by using this bulking solution. In this paper, the glyoxal structure both in reagent and in bulking solution were detected by infrared spectro and mass spectra, the result shows that there is no aldehyde group but only hydrate existing in both solutions. Besides, the mechanism of the action between glyoxal and waterlogged wood is discussed and some problems like how to prevent the bulking solution from acidification are also mentioned.
